Sometimes horrible things happen, like these massive fires that
are destroying thousands of homes, wildlife, and people's lives.
Prayers always feel as if they are so small compared to the
enormity of the circumstances like this. At first the prayers
start out with "loud cries and shouts" unto the Lord for mercy
and help. Then day by day, the prayers begin to wane and thin
out.
Because of the overwhelming catastrope of it, hearts become
slowly extinguished. Not for any lack of care and sincere
concern, but the feeling is as if the thing is too big and heavy
to carry. Silently prayers decline.
These fires are only an example of a great thing, but there are
other weighty matters too.These fires will eventually be put out
but there will be other kinds of fires in the lives of many
people. Fires of all kinds of heavy things.
At first there is the natural outcry of prayer, but after that it
is important to get yourself quiet. Do not feel you need to do so
much personal heavy lifting when you yourself need lifting up.
You have to spiritually pace yourself.
I love what Amy Carmichael says:
"So wait before the Lord; Wait in the stillness. And in that
stillness, assurance will come to you. You will know that you are
heard; you will know that your Lord ponders the voice of your
humble desires; you will hear quiet words spoken to you yourself,
perhaps to your grateful surprise and refreshment."
She is right, and when we wait before the Lord, His comfort will
come and you will be led into the path of prayer "paved with
love."
You will come to realize that you do not have to say a whole lot
to Him. When you find yourself saying, "Lord, I cannot do this,
it is too heavy for me, but it's not too heavy for you!" God will
then meet your faith and answer. He delights in the one who looks
up to Him.
"And it shall come to pass, that before they call, I will answer;
and while they are yet speaking, I will hear." Isaiah 65:24.
“Prayer is the quiet, persistent living of our life of desire and
faith in the presence of our God.”― Andrew Murray
